PRODUCT DESCRIPTION

Blancaneaux is Inglenook's own answer to the white wines of the Rhône Valley — a genuinely distinctive blend built from Viognier, Marsanne, and Roussanne, grown at Rutherford, the historic Napa Valley sub-appellation where Gustave Niebaum completed his winery in 1887 and named it "Inglenook," a property that remains, to this day, the oldest bonded winery in California. Inglenook has practiced organic farming since the 1980s, and was one of the very first Napa Valley estates to receive organic certification, back in 1994 — a genuine point of pride that continues to shape every wine the estate produces, Blancaneaux included.

The 2021 vintage runs 43% Viognier, 30% Roussanne, and 27% Marsanne, fermented in a deliberate split between stainless steel drums (60%) and 500-liter oak puncheons (40%) — a technique designed to preserve the wine's natural freshness while still building some textural richness from the oak component. Inglenook's own team describes the estate as "forever a work-in-progress," with ongoing experimentation embedded directly in its DNA as it continues evaluating climate change, vine age, and vintage variation year over year.

The critical reception has been genuinely strong: James Suckling awarded 95 Points, describing the wine as "full and fresh with beautiful fruit and firm phenolics that give excellent texture," with notes of "acacia" and "lemon rind," alongside "dried fruits at the end," recommending it be enjoyed "or held" through 2028. Wine-Searcher's aggregated critic data places the vintage at 93/100 overall. Wine.com's own tasting found "intriguing Viognier-derived florals and gingery spice, framed by hints of crushed stone and pineapple," describing the wine as "medium-bodied, plump and silky in feel, with a long, refreshing finish." Inglenook's own winemaker notes describe the 2021 as showing "pale gold color," leading "with aromas of honey, white peach, and pomelo," the palate "fresh," with "absolute purity of flavor," a "lingering minerality" carrying "the wine through a long aromatic finish" — the team calling it "an eminently ageable vintage." This is genuinely serious, food-friendly white Rhône-style wine from one of Napa Valley's most historically significant estates.
